Transaction 98795898b9d6bbec70b57f13eca395882f7b28194492e27cc8c330b36f0a2367
1 Input
1 Output
-
98795898b9d6bbec70b57f13eca395882f7b28194492e27cc8c330b36f0a2367:0
- value
- 395800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f56de0b68da5211953ec919c94bb1b6baf9e1f4 OP_EQUAL
- address
- 3LbKruK6KdfDy3ZyQjtnKJkoihADP64vhj